The "Status on VOICEROID" page acts as a guide for readers and editors alike. The "Status" page lists all the voicebanks produced using VOICEROID technology; this includes any commercial releases, announcements, developments, and projects involving the VOICEROID franchise.

Cancelled Vocals
These are VOICEROID voicebanks known to be cancelled.
Product | Developer | Summary |
---|---|---|
Koharu Rikka | TOKYO6 ENTERTAINMENT | Koharu Rikka is a Japanese female voicebank (VP:Yoshino Aoyama) developed by TOKYO6 Entertainment. A crowdfunded vocal, she was originally announced as a new VOICEROID project, to which a stretch goal including a singing synthesis database was added, which was reached on June 7, 2020.[2] It was confirmed in the press release by AHS that she would be receiving a Synthesizer V voice database.[3] Her VOICEROID2 bank was cancelled in favor of a CeVIO AI Talk bank.[4] |
